## Onboarding: Fareweight Rules Engine

Fareweight computes shipping fees from stacked rule sets. Rules are versioned; never edit a live version. Deploys go through the staging evaluator first. Read the rule DSL guide before touching anything.

Rule definitions live in the pricing database — connect to it with the connection string below.

primary connection of yagep-bajop = postgresql://druiel_svc:gW@db-3860.sivrelworks.example:5432/brieth

## Changelog — Frostvault 3.1: archive defaults changed

Cold storage buckets in Frostvault now archive after 30 days of inactivity instead of 90, and lifecycle sweeps run nightly rather than weekly. Restore requests keep the old priority queue behavior. Reviewers should confirm no test fixtures assume the former thresholds. The new default configuration values shipped with this release are as follows.

deployment values, yadug-bawif:
[framir]
team = pelox
access_code = ac_a38ab2
owner = tamion.julael
host = framir.tolvaqlabs.test
port = 11211
peer = tammir.zemvargrid.local
salt = 2215ef03
pin = 1541

## v2.8.1 — PickPath Optimizer

Fixed an edge case where the bin-clustering heuristic produced overlapping routes when a zone contained exactly one oversized item. The solver now falls back to nearest-neighbor ordering for singleton zones, with a regression test covering the Hollowgate warehouse layout. No schema changes; config defaults unchanged. Please review the fallback threshold carefully. Changes authored and owned by the following engineer.

signatory, yagap-bawig: Ulaath Eliath

Quick heads-up for the sync: we changed the default fan-out backpressure behavior. Previously Pushwren would buffer unbounded when downstream delivery workers lagged, which is how we got that memory blowup during the Harvold launch. Now the dispatcher sheds load once the queue depth crosses the high-water mark and re-admits gradually. Most teams won't notice anything; heavy broadcasters might see slightly slower fan-out under spikes, which is the point. The new defaults that ship with this release are as follows.

config for yawep-tajef:
[kelion]
team = kelys
access_code = ac_1a130d
owner = holax.aldmir
host = kelion.urlaqforge.example
port = 9090
peer = fenmir.lumicio.example
salt = d0dd3cb5
pin = 3295